Co-Ordinator Customer Service Administration
Our client is one of the UK’s largest suppliers of building and construction steel reinforcement solutions for the construction and civils industry. The company has experienced growth, increasing turnover and expanding its service capabilities. They support employee training and personal development and are now looking to expand their operations in Sheffield.
This role is suitable for individuals with a background in customer service, contracts support, civil engineering, or administration. The successful candidate will support a busy contracts and sales office, handling functions such as invoicing, report writing, customer and competitor research, order status, and transportation. The role involves answering calls and assisting internal contacts and customers with orders and queries. Additionally, the role includes supporting the administration of the depot, working with internal departments, sister companies, and various operational teams.
Applicants should demonstrate strong experience in customer service and administration, ideally within civil engineering, construction contracts, manufacturing, or engineering sectors. Attention to detail, a strong work ethic, and the ability to manage administrative functions within a technical environment are essential. Experience in managing business administration within a small team is advantageous. The candidate should be proactive in supporting internal departments and sales teams in a dynamic office environment.
Basic salary: £24,000 - £26,000 plus package.
